Escalador Automático de Pod

Descripción: Un Escalador Automático de Pod es una herramienta esencial en el ecosistema de contenedores orquestados, diseñada para optimizar la gestión de recursos en aplicaciones desplegadas en entornos dinámicos. Su función principal es ajustar automáticamente el número de Pods en un despliegue, basándose en la utilización de CPU u otras métricas seleccionadas, como la memoria o el tráfico de red. Esto permite a las aplicaciones escalar hacia arriba o hacia abajo en respuesta a la demanda, garantizando un uso eficiente de los recursos y mejorando la disponibilidad y el rendimiento. Los escaladores automáticos son fundamentales en entornos de microservicios, donde las cargas de trabajo pueden variar significativamente. Al automatizar el proceso de escalado, los desarrolladores y administradores de sistemas pueden centrarse en la optimización de la aplicación y la experiencia del usuario, en lugar de gestionar manualmente los recursos. Además, el escalado automático contribuye a la reducción de costos operativos, ya que permite a las organizaciones pagar solo por los recursos que realmente utilizan. En resumen, el Escalador Automático de Pod es una característica clave que potencia la flexibilidad y eficiencia de las aplicaciones en entornos de contenedores, adaptándose dinámicamente a las necesidades cambiantes del entorno de producción.

Historia: El concepto de escalado automático en entornos de contenedores comenzó a ganar popularidad con la adopción de tecnologías de orquestación de contenedores, como Kubernetes, que fue lanzado por Google en 2014. Varios sistemas de gestión de contenedores incorporaron esta funcionalidad para facilitar la gestión de aplicaciones en contenedores. A lo largo de los años, el escalado automático ha evolucionado, integrando métricas más allá de la CPU, como la memoria y el uso de recursos personalizados, lo que ha permitido un control más granular y eficiente de los recursos en entornos de producción.

Usos: El Escalador Automático de Pod se utiliza principalmente en entornos de producción donde las aplicaciones experimentan fluctuaciones en la carga de trabajo. Permite a las organizaciones mantener un rendimiento óptimo de sus aplicaciones, asegurando que haya suficientes recursos disponibles durante picos de demanda y reduciendo la cantidad de recursos durante períodos de baja actividad. Esto es especialmente útil en aplicaciones web, servicios de microservicios y plataformas de comercio electrónico, donde la demanda puede variar significativamente a lo largo del tiempo.

Ejemplos: Un ejemplo práctico del uso del Escalador Automático de Pod es en una aplicación de comercio electrónico durante el Black Friday, donde el tráfico puede aumentar drásticamente. El escalador ajusta automáticamente el número de Pods para manejar el aumento de usuarios, asegurando que la aplicación permanezca disponible y responda rápidamente. Otro caso es en aplicaciones de streaming de video, donde el escalador puede aumentar los Pods durante eventos en vivo y reducirlos cuando la demanda disminuye.

  • Rating:
  • 3
  • (5)

Deja tu comentario

Tu dirección de correo electrónico no será publicada. Los campos obligatorios están marcados con *

PATROCINADORES

Glosarix en tu dispositivo

instalar
×
Enable Notifications Ok No